[lane C] Round 2 WIP (session cut off): schema v2, surf-aware pacing, chase analysis, --probe
Landed before the cut: schema v2 (segments[].wave.amp override, validated — breathe stays biome-owned); hiatus re-authored tight AND calm (radius back to 6.5, amp 0.6, 3.3u steady clearance); par 210 -> 180 with full rationale (below throttle-only par-pace, above a surf run — the medal teaches the mechanic); finale surge 21 -> 24 so surfing is the stylish escape (required 1.20x); surf profile reads A's live CREST_FACTOR; chaseAnalysis() + escapability laws in validate; NEW --probe builds A's real canal and measures clearance against the model (all L2 segments clear the 2.5 floor, hiatus 3.75); isMain guard + importSpline shim — fixes A's selfcheck process.exit killing C's mid-run (qa.sh had been green on one level out of three). Cut off before: fly-through of the integrated build (blocked on B), pickup economy handover (B proposed numbers in balance.js meanwhile — reconcile), L1 encounter design doc, GDD boss folding, NOTES. Committed by F to protect the shared tree; levels selfcheck 3/3 GREEN. Co-Authored-By: Claude Fable 5 <noreply@anthropic.com>

"par_rationale": "180s (3:00), retuned in round 2 for the CREST 1.6 surf ruling. Measured: a perfect crest ride is 2:26, throttle-mashing is 2:47, par-pace throttle (1.15x) is 3:19, timid is 4:22. So par 3:00 sits BELOW throttle-only competent play and ABOVE a surf run: you cannot reach it by holding the stick forward, and you can reach it comfortably by learning to surf. That is deliberate - L2's signature mechanic is riding peristalsis crests, and the time medal is the thing that teaches it. Par is a medal threshold, not a pass condition: missing it costs a medal, not the level.",

"note": "BEAT 6 - SPIKE, and the level's precision test. The tightest hole in the game: the esophagus threads the diaphragm. TIGHT AND CALM is the whole design - schema v2's wave override (amp 0.6 vs the esophagus's 1.4) exists for this segment. Anatomically the hiatus is a fixed muscular ring held by the diaphragm crura and does NOT have big peristaltic waves; mechanically, a big wave in the smallest gap turned a precision setpiece into a lottery you cannot stop to time. Calm waves let the tube go back to base 6.5 (it was widened to 6.8 in round 1 purely to survive the biome-wide amp) and still leave 3.3 units of steady clearance. Steady-tight is a skill; pulsing-tight is a toll. Straightened out (curviness 0.3) for the same reason: the challenge is the ring gate's timing, and a writhing tube would make that unreadable."
